Ingredients

The heart of this bowl is a fragrant cilantro‑lime rice that acts as a neutral canvas for a colorful medley of beans, corn, and crisp veggies. The dressing, made from lime juice, olive oil, and a touch of garlic, brings acidity and shine. Optional protein adds substance without overwhelming the fresh profile, while avocado and a sprinkle of cheese provide creamy contrast.

Main Components

  • 1 cup long‑grain white rice
  • 1 ¾ cups water
  • 1 cup canned black beans, rinsed and drained
  • ½ cup frozen corn kernels, thawed
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
  • ¼ cup red onion, finely diced

Cilantro Lime Dressing

  • ¼ cup fresh cilantro leaves, loosely packed
  • 2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lime juice
  • 1 teaspoon lime zest
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 small garlic clove, minced

Seasonings & Garnish

  • ½ teaspoon ground cumin
  • ¼ teaspoon chili powder (optional)
  • Salt and freshly cracked black pepper, to taste
  • 1 ripe avocado, sliced
  • ¼ cup crumbled feta or cotija cheese (optional)
  • Optional: 12 oz grilled chicken breast, sliced

Each ingredient plays a purpose: the rice soaks up the citrusy dressing, beans add protein and earthiness, corn contributes a pop of sweetness, and the fresh veggies bring crunch. The cilantro‑lime sauce unifies the bowl with acidity, while cumin and chili powder lend a subtle warmth. Finishing with avocado and cheese introduces creaminess that balances the bright flavors, creating a harmonious, satisfying meal.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Zesty Cilantro Lime Rice Bowls: A Fresh and Flavorful Delight

Cooking the Rice

Rinse the rice under cold water until the water runs clear to remove excess starch. Combine the rice and water in a medium saucepan, bring to a rolling boil, then reduce to a gentle simmer, cover, and cook for 15‑18 minutes until the grains are tender and the liquid is absorbed. Let it sit, covered, for 5 minutes before fluffing with a fork; this creates a light, separate texture that soaks up the dressing beautifully.

Preparing the Dressing & Veggies

  1. Blend the Dressing. In a food processor or blender, combine cilantro, lime juice, zest, olive oil, minced garlic, cumin, and chili powder. Pulse until smooth, then season with salt and pepper. The emulsion should be glossy and bright; this will coat the rice evenly and impart a fresh zing.
  2. Toast the Corn. Heat a dry skillet over medium heat. Add the thawed corn kernels and cook, stirring occasionally, for 3‑4 minutes until lightly browned and fragrant. Toasting deepens the sweetness and adds a subtle nutty note that balances the acidity of the dressing.
  3. Combine Beans and Veggies. In a large mixing bowl, toss black beans, cherry tomatoes, red onion, and the toasted corn. Drizzle a tablespoon of the cilantro‑lime dressing over the mixture and stir gently. This pre‑seasoning infuses the vegetables with flavor while keeping their textures distinct.

Assembling the Bowls

  1. Flavor the Rice. Transfer the cooked rice to the bowl of vegetables. Pour the remaining cilantro‑lime dressing over the rice and gently fold until every grain is lightly coated. The rice should take on a pale green hue, indicating the lime and cilantro have been fully incorporated.
  2. Add Protein (Optional). If using grilled chicken, slice it into bite‑size strips and arrange on top of the rice. The warm protein adds heartiness and makes the bowl a complete meal.
  3. Finish with Fresh Elements. Top each bowl with sliced avocado, a sprinkle of feta or cotija cheese, and an extra pinch of cilantro if desired. The avocado adds buttery richness, while the cheese contributes a salty contrast that rounds out the flavor profile.

Serving

Serve the bowls immediately while the rice is warm and the vegetables retain their crispness. Offer lime wedges on the side for an extra burst of acidity, and enjoy the vibrant colors and textures that make each bite exciting.

Tips & Tricks

Perfecting the Recipe

Rinse Rice Thoroughly: Removing surface starch prevents gummy rice and ensures each grain stays separate, perfect for absorbing the citrus dressing.

Use Fresh Lime Juice: Bottled juice lacks the bright aroma of fresh limes; a real squeeze adds an unmistakable zing that defines the bowl.

Season As You Go: Lightly salt the beans and corn before mixing; this layers flavor and prevents a bland final product.

Flavor Enhancements

Add a pinch of smoked paprika for a subtle smoky depth, or stir in a tablespoon of chopped roasted peanuts for crunch. A drizzle of extra‑virgin olive oil right before serving amplifies the richness and rounds out the acidity.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Don’t over‑mix the rice after adding the dressing; vigorous stirring can mash the grains and create a mushy texture. Also, avoid using wilted cilantro—fresh, bright leaves are essential for the signature flavor and color.

Pro Tips

Prep Ahead: Make the dressing and toast the corn up to 24 hours in advance; store in airtight containers to save time on busy nights.

Warm the Bowl: Pre‑warm serving bowls in the oven for a few minutes; this keeps the rice warm longer and enhances the overall eating experience.

Balance Acidity: Taste the dressing before adding it to the rice; if it feels too sharp, whisk in a teaspoon of honey or agave to mellow the edge.

Variations

Ingredient Swaps

Replace white rice with brown rice, quinoa, or cauliflower rice for a different texture and added nutrients. Swap black beans for pinto or chickpeas, and use fresh or grilled corn instead of frozen. For a protein boost, try shrimp, tempeh, or even a fried egg on top.

Dietary Adjustments

To keep the bowl gluten‑free, ensure any packaged spices are certified gluten‑free. For a vegan version, omit cheese and use a plant‑based protein such as marinated tofu. Keto diners can substitute the rice with cauliflower rice and use a low‑carb sweetener instead of honey in the dressing.

Serving Suggestions

Serve the bowls alongside a simple cucumber‑mint salad or a side of roasted sweet potatoes for extra heartiness. A dollop of Greek yogurt or a spoonful of guacamole adds creaminess, while a handful of toasted pepitas provides an enjoyable crunch.

Storage Info

Leftover Storage

Allow the bowls to cool to room temperature, then transfer each portion to an airtight container. Store in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. For longer keeping, separate the dressing from the rice and freeze the rice‑bean‑corn mixture in freezer‑safe bags for up to 3 months; the dressing can be frozen in a small container as well.

Reheating Instructions

Reheat the rice mixture in a skillet over medium heat, adding a splash of water or broth to restore moisture, for 4‑5 minutes while stirring. If using the oven, cover the bowl with foil and heat at 350°F for 12‑15 minutes. Add fresh avocado and dressing after reheating to keep flavors bright.
